Versions
Skribble's Sign API has three versions. v2 is the current stable version recommended for all production integrations. v3 is available as a preview — try it in non-production environments and share your feedback.
For how Skribble versions its APIs in general — what counts as a breaking vs. additive change, and how long previous versions are supported — see Versioning.
API v1 End of Support
Sign API v1 reached end of support on 30 November 2025. After this date, v1 remains functional but breaking changes may be introduced without notice. If you are still on v1, upgrade to v2.

What's New in v3
Multi-Document Requests
A single signature request can contain up to 50 documents. All documents are signed together in one flow, which reduces friction for complex processes that would otherwise require multiple separate requests.
Draft Workflow
Signature requests can be created in DRAFT status and fully configured before being initiated. This lets you assemble documents, add signers, and set options across multiple API calls before committing — no more needing to get everything right in a single create call.
Express QES (xQES)
Both v2 and v3 support Express QES — a streamlined qualified electronic signature flow with identification-related endpoints that allow signers to complete the QES process without leaving your application.
Signer and Observer Groups
v3 introduces groups for both signers and observers:
- Signer groups — define parallel or sequential signing workflows. Signers in the same group can sign in any order; groups are completed sequentially.
- Observer groups — grant stakeholders read-only access to the request and its documents without being part of the signing flow.
Base URLs
Skribble hosts data in two regions. Choose the region that matches your data residency requirements and use it consistently across all API calls.
| Region | Sign API v2 | Sign API v3 |
|---|---|---|
| Switzerland (CH) | https://api.skribble.com/v2 | https://api.skribble.com/v3 |
| Germany (DE) | https://api.skribble.de/v2 | https://api.skribble.de/v3 |
